Played with breathtaking intensity by Ramya Krishnan, Neelambari is widely regarded as one of the most powerful female antagonists in Indian cinema. Driven by toxic pride, unrequited love, and a desire for vengeance, Neelambari rejects the traditional submissive roles often assigned to women in 90s cinema. Padayappa is frequently cited as the movie that features one of the greatest antagonist performances in Indian cinema history. Ramya Krishnan’s portrayal of Neelambari—a fiercely obsessive, arrogant, and brilliant woman scorned by Padayappa’s rejection—matched Rajinikanth’s on-screen energy step-for-step.
